Issues in Global Social Work Practice

SW648

Credits: 1
Prerequisites: None

Course Description

This class is for students who will be going abroad at the end of the Winter semester (e.g., students who will be completing a global field placement, global independent study, or Peace Corps service).

This course is designed to help prepare social work students for professional practice during a global social work experience, as well as to help integrate that experience into the broader educational experience at UM-SSW. Students will critically examine the impact of their positionalities, assumptions, values, theories and practice models and begin to develop a practice framework that is ethical, relevant and effective in a global setting.
